您好,欢迎访问上海聚搜信息技术有限公司官方网站!

宜春华为云代理商:按需动态加载js

时间:2024-02-12 20:51:01 点击:

宜春华为云代理商:按需动态加载js

一、什么是按需动态加载js

按需动态加载js是指根据页面需求,在特定条件下才加载相应的JavaScript脚本文件。通过按需动态加载js,可以提高网页的加载速度和响应性能,减少不必要的资源消耗。

二、为什么选择按需动态加载js

1. 提高网页加载速度:按需动态加载js可以根据需要加载脚本文件,避免一次性加载所有脚本导致的长时间等待。

2. 减少资源消耗:按需动态加载js可以根据用户操作或页面条件加载相应的脚本,避免不必要的资源浪费。

3. 提升用户体验:快速响应用户操作,减少页面加载时间,能够提高用户体验和用户留存率。

三、华为云服务器产品的优势

作为宜春华为云代理商,我们推荐使用华为云服务器作为按需动态加载js的主要平台。以下是华为云服务器产品的优势:

1. 强大的计算能力:华为云服务器配置高性能硬件,提供强大的计算能力和稳定性。

2. 灵活的扩展性:华为云服务器支持自定义配置,按需扩展硬件资源,满足不同应用场景的需求。

3. 高效的网络传输:华为云服务器采用高速网络通信,保证数据传输的速度和稳定性。

四、如何实现按需动态加载js

1. 根据条件判断加载:根据页面的特定条件,使用JavaScript判断是否需要加载某个脚本文件。

2. 动态创建script标签:使用JavaScript动态创建script标签,并设置src属性为需要加载的脚本文件的路径。

3. 插入到文档中:将动态创建的script标签插入到页面的head或body标签中,完成脚本加载。

五、实例:按需动态加载Google地图API

以按需动态加载Google地图API为例,展示如何在华为云服务器上实现按需动态加载js:

1. 条件判断

if (需要加载地图的条件) {
  // 动态加载Google地图API
} else {
  // 不需要加载地图
}

2. 动态创建script标签

var script = document.createElement("script");
script.src = "https://maps.googleapis.com/maps/api/js?key=YOUR_API_KEY";

3. 插入到文档中

document.head.appendChild(script);

六、总结

按需动态加载js是一种提高网页性能的有效手段,可以根据页面需求灵活加载JavaScript脚本文件。华为云服务器作为宜春华为云代理商的推荐产品,具备强大的计算能力、灵活的扩展性和高效的网络传输,能够满足按需动态加载js的需求。通过条件判断、动态创建script标签以及插入到文档中,我们可以实现按需动态加载各类js资源,提升网页性能和用户体验。

阿里云优惠券领取
腾讯云优惠券领取
QQ在线咨询
售前咨询热线
133-2199-9693
售后咨询热线
4008-020-360

微信扫一扫

加客服咨询